When Iovan Works Best

Iovan is best suited for display purposes. It excels as a logo font, headline font, or accent font. Its strength lies in short phrases, where its details can be fully appreciated. It works well in editorial design, packaging, and commercial assets where visual impact is key.

Pairing it with a serif or sans serif font can help balance its complexity. A simple, clean typeface can provide contrast and clarity, allowing Iovan to take center stage without clashing. For example, using it alongside a classic serif like Baskerville or a modern sans like Helvetica Neue can create a refined, professional look.

It also pairs well with script fonts for a more expressive feel, especially in creative projects that require a personal touch. However, it’s important to test these combinations in real design scenarios to ensure they don’t become visually busy or confusing.

Limitations and Considerations

While Iovan is a strong display font, it’s not ideal for all applications. In long-form text, it can become difficult to read, especially at smaller sizes. It’s not suitable for formal corporate use where simplicity and clarity are prioritized. If the goal is to communicate information quickly, Iovan might not be the best choice.

For small print or low-resolution screens, the font’s intricate details can get lost. It’s best used in high-quality prints or digital displays where its nuances can be clearly seen. When working with clients, I always recommend testing the font in the final output environment before committing to it.

Another thing to keep in mind is licensing. Before using Iovan in client work, packaging, or merchandise, it’s essential to check the commercial license terms. Some fonts have restrictions on usage, and understanding those upfront can save time and avoid legal issues down the line.
